​Learning by Doing: Grade 5 Students Create Colourful Butterfly Wristbands: 2nd June 2026

 June 2, 2026: Alevoor Poornaprajna Public School's Grade 5 students enjoyed an engaging and creative SUPW (Socially Useful Productive Work) session that combined learning, craftsmanship, and fun.


The activity involved designing and assembling vibrant butterfly wristbands, allowing students to explore their artistic talents while developing essential fine motor skills. With colourful materials and boundless imagination, the young learners enthusiastically crafted unique wristbands, each reflecting their creativity and personal style.

The classroom buzzed with excitement as students collaborated, shared ideas, and helped one another throughout the process. The activity not only enhanced hand-eye coordination and precision but also encouraged teamwork, patience, and self-expression.

The joyful smiles and beautifully crafted wristbands were a testament to the success of the session. Through hands-on learning experiences such as these, APPS continues to nurture creativity, confidence, and practical skills among its students.

It was indeed a memorable and colourful day for the Grade 5 learners, leaving them with both new skills and cherished memories.
